ABSENCES FOR RELIGIOUS OBLIGATION
We have a new form in the front office (it is also located on the HCPSS website www.hcpss.org). The implementation date of the revised policy, The Absence for Religious Obligation form is January 22, 2008. The form must be completed for consideration of an excused absence from school under Policy 3000, Religious Observances. All requests should be submitted two weeks in advance to the principal, who will forward them to the Office of Equity Assurance. In accordance with Policy 9010, Attendance, students returning from lawful absences have an equal number of days to complete make-up work. Questions regarding Policy 3000 may be directed to the Office of Equity Assurance at 410/313-6654. So that both parents and school officials can retain a copy for their records, the new form is provided on 3 part carbonless paper.

DRESSING FOR COLDER WEATHER!
Parents please make sure that your child(ren) are dressed appropriately for the colder weather. Students will still be going outdoors for recess (unless temperature falls below 20). There are other times that students may be required to go outside, fire drills/evacuations and occasionally P.E. Long pants, coats, hats and gloves are necessary to be comfortable outdoors.
